Man City signing Soyuncu is bad for Laporte

Manchester City have been linked with a move for Leicester defender Caglar Soyuncu recently, and his potential signing would be bad news for Aymeric Laporte’s future in Pep Guardiola’s side at the Etihad Stadium.

According to sources in Turkey, Manchester City are best placed to sign the centre-back this summer despite interest from fellow Premier League clubs Manchester United and Chelsea, whilst Paris Saint-Germain, Real Madrid and Barcelona are also said to be keen.

The 25-year-old has established himself as one of the best players in his position since joining Leicester City from Freiburg in 2018 and was a regular in Brendan Rodgers’ side last season as they narrowly missed out on a top four spot.

His performances in the Bundesliga were enough to earn him comparisons to Germany international Mats Hummels and he has certainly caught the eye during his time in the Premier League thus far.

Although injury problems limited him to just 23 appearances in the top flight last season, his performances in the 2019/20 season, where he made 34 appearances and averaged a superb 7.04 rating from WhoScored, emphasise his quality as a top Premier League defender.

Any deal for the £40.5m-rated centre-back would not be cheap, as he is contracted at the King Power Stadium until 2023, which suggests that if he were to make the move to the Etihad this summer, a centre-back would need to be sold.

The most likely candidate to leave seems to be Laporte, who has been linked with a move back to La Liga after losing his starting spot at City last season due to the impressive form of Ruben Dias and John Stones.

As Guardiola has another left-sided centre-back in Nathan Ake who can fill in for either Dias or Stones, a player of Laporte’s quality would surely be less than happy if he were forced to compete with another centre-back should Soyuncu arrive, so an exit could well be on the cards for the Spain international.

Leeds: Illan Meslier’s value has gone up 700%

Since emerging as Leeds United’s number one goalkeeper, Illan Meslier has shown exactly why many at the club believe him to be an integral part of their future.

Speaking on The Inside Elland Road Podcast just over a year ago, The Yorkshire Evening Post’s Graham Smyth said: “He’s been great, hasn’t he? For a 20-year-old, for £5m, I mean Victor Orta – it feels almost illegal what he’s done getting a player of that quality at that age for £5m, remarkable business.”

The towering Frenchman joined from Lorient, and after usurping Kiko Casilla to become the Whites’ first-choice shot-stopper, has become one of the Premier League’s most promising goalkeepers, if not the most.

Still only 22, Meslier has racked up considerable top-flight experience by playing week-in and week-out, and enjoyed a superb debut campaign at the highest level last season.

With a total of 11 clean sheets to his name in the Premier League, Meslier ranked joint-fifth among all goalkeepers in the division, and that despite playing for a side who have come to be known for their more attacking style of play and committing men forward.

Aside from his shot-stopping though, the young Frenchman’s ability with his feet has always been one of his standout attributes, with former Whites striker Jermaine Beckford raving: “The kid is incredible. I was watching the game (against Everton) and there were a couple of moments, (Dominic) Calvert-Lewin, Richarlison and James (Rodriguez) had chances, but Meslier stood in their way. His distribution is one of the best in the Premier League.”

Indeed, Meslier’s willingness to come for crosses and take the pressure of his defenders has also been raved about by former England goalkeeper David James, who said earlier this calendar year: “Meslier – I love him. I went on social media, I was watching a game and he went for about 10 crosses (v Burnley), he carried on coming for crosses.

“The commentators were battering him. I was thinking ‘the guy is still coming’, and as soon as the whistle went, the camera was panning but you could see all the defenders going up to him. That is quality.”

His performances in the Premier League have now seen his value shoot up, with CIES now rating him at a mammoth £40m – an increase of eight times his initial fee.

There’s no questioning that Victor Orta struck a dream deal by landing a goalkeeper for both the present and the future, for so cheap.

Newcastle must start Joelinton vs West Ham

As Newcastle United get their Premier League season underway on Sunday afternoon, Steve Bruce will have some big calls to make over his starting line-up.

The Magpies have only signed one new player in Joe Willock, and many of the manager’s options remain the squad which endured a disappointing campaign in the top-flight last term.

However, one man who will be hoping to finally get his Newcastle career going is Joelinton.

The Brazilian has been nothing short of a disaster at St James’ Park since his big-money move from Hoffenheim, netting just ten goals in 80 games across all competitions, but pre-season has seen him hit a touch of form at the right time, which bodes well for the West Ham clash today and the rest of the campaign.

According to The Athletic’s Chris Waugh: “Whisper it quietly, but Joelinton may finally start to deliver (to an extent) this season.

“Not to anywhere near the level of the £40 million Newcastle paid for him, but perhaps we need to completely forget about that ludicrous price tag and look at what he can actually offer.

“Well-placed sources believe that, with the Brazilian’s English improving and the No 9 shirt now on Wilson’s back instead of his, he has been a more confident and self-assured presence on the training ground. While he may not be an automatic starter in the strongest XI, Joelinton could yet contribute more than the six goals and four assists he has to show for 69 Premier League appearances so far…”

With Wilson now the main man tasked with leading the line for the Magpies, Joelinton may finally feel like he has a weight off his shoulders and can go about playing his own game without the added pressure of the number nine shirt.

Given that he’s shown some impressive signs in the last few weeks, Bruce would do well to capitalise and unleash the Brazilian against the Hammers later this afternoon.

The £17m-rated ace could kickstart Newcastle’s, and just as importantly, his own season with a bang today.

Matt Maher drops Villa transfer news on Tuanzebe

The Express and Star’s Matt Maher has dropped an update on Aston Villa transfer target Axel Tuanzebe.

What’s the story?

Reports in recent weeks have claimed that the Manchester United defender could be making a return to Villa Park this summer as Dean Smith looks to strengthen his centre-back options.

Football Insider revealed: “A Villa source has told Football Insider that the club have been given encouragement that United are planning to let Tuanzebe go in the current window.”

Maher has now confirmed that Villa have registered their interest in signing Tuanzebe, although fellow Premier League side Newcastle are also said to be keen on him.

Villa fans will be buzzing

Maher’s update that Villa are in for Tuanzebe will surely have fans buzzing, especially considering that Smith is desperately short of genuine quality cover in terms of his centre-back options.

Former England goalkeeper Paul Robinson has already thrown his backing behind a potential Villa move for the Manchester United defender. He said: “At 23, if you’re not getting a sniff at your own club, it’s not a good sign. The under-23 league that’s been brought in gives people a false sense of security that you’re going to be a footballer at 23.

“If you’re 20 or 21 and you’re not training with the first team at that point, you’ve probably missed the boat. He’s got quality. But I think for him, at this stage in his career, he’s not at Man United level. So he probably needs to move elsewhere. Somewhere like Aston Villa would be perfect for himself and for the good of his career.”

With Smith and Villa already aware of Tuanzebe’s quality given his previous loan spell at the club, featuring 28 times in their promotion-winning 2018/19 Championship campaign, the defender should be able to hit the ground running at Villa Park.

Fans will likely be buzzing at the prospect of the 23-year-old once again donning a Villa shirt for next season.
